1, Take quiet time or actively meditate. Still your mind and empty your thoughts. Get used to being alone and being quiet. Only when you do this will the true you begin to emerge. Distractions keep you pinned to the same position and hinder your growth. Spend time in nature and truly appreciate this planet we live on.
2, Start a journal and try and make it a daily habit to get out whatever is inside of you. Hopes, dreams, fears, successes and failures. We carry around a lot of baggage that sometimes we can just get rid of by expressing it. Looking back over time will enable you too see just how far you have come.
3, Create a Vision Board of how you want your future to look like and feel like. You can do this physically with a scrap book and magazine cuttings or on Pinterest. I do both! By doing this you are setting a goal for your subconscious..something that is actually tangible rather than a vague, flimsy dream.
4, Start a gratitude list and add at least 3 things to it daily. There is always something to be grateful for, no matter how small. Warm house, clean clothes, food to eat. What you focus your attention on grows. Again, when the storm comes having this list helps. You will see how you have always been provided for and blessed, and you will be again.
5, Create a set of affirmations or take one at a time and work on it until you have grasped it and absorbed the meaning. There are times where I have felt far from abundant and petrified of where my money was coming from. This is where I meditiate on ‘I am abundance and prosperity’ over and over until my subconscious has grasped it and pulled me out of the feeling of lack that was pulling me under.
6, Surround yourself with uplifting/inspiring people. Those who are further down their own path have so much to offer you. Listen to what they have to say. They have lived it and worked things through. I try to do this with limiting my TV time and reading the paper too. I have a general awareness of what is happening in the world, but I am mindful of what is going into my subconscious. The ways of the world can be draining and mind-numbing. I read motivational books, follow inspiring people on Facebook and listen to motivational speakers on Youtube. A lot!
7, Be creative in whatever way suits you. Sing, paint, draw, play an instrument, write, sew..Whatever it is. The finished product is not what is important, it is allowing yourself that time and freedom to be creative. For me, creativity is freedom. I paint, not because I want to create a pretty picture but because I have something inside of me that needs to be expressed. By blocking your creativity you are blocking a vital piece of you.
8,Be kind to yourself. Life can be hard. It isn’t always plain sailing. With the happy and joyful moments come the moments of pain and sorrow. Be your own best friend and learn to love yourself. Listen to your own needs. Let the emotions come but don’t let them own you. Know that everything will pass. It always does.
9, Relax and let go. Know that you have set your intentions with your vision board, you have left your baggage with your journal and you are working on your subconscious thinking with your affirmations. There is now nothing else you can. Let go. Do not mentally carry that problem. Worry does not get you anywhere. Surrender to the flow and know that what will be will be.
